Hyaluronic acid-based lubricant

Hyaluronic acid-based lube is a natural solution for dry and itchy vaginas. Its formulation is pH-balanced, water-based, and free of fragrance and hormones. It is also compatible with condoms and sex toys. It is a dermatologist-recommended. Hyaluronic acid has been proven to increase the pleasure and elasticity of your cervix.

Hyaluronic acid is a naturally occurring molecule found in skin and joints. Because it is so good at hydrating the skin and regulating pH levels, it is beneficial for reducing symptoms associated with menopause. Bonafide uses a proprietary process to create hyaluronic acid without animal-based ingredients. Hyaluronic acid is not harmful to the environment, as it is obtained from a natural source.

Menopause affects the production of hyaluronic acid, an essential molecule in skin moisture. As women age, their levels of this molecule decrease, leading to dryness and vaginal pain. On the other hand, hyaluronic acid-based lubricants conserve water molecules, promoting vaginal moisture. However, they do not address the problems caused by the hormonal changes associated with menopause.

Natural vaginal moisturizer

Dryness and irritation of the vaginal region are common complaints of women after menopause. They can be so uncomfortable that women may decide to forgo intercourse. Women who suffer from vaginal dryness may not associate it with menopause and just believe that aging will cause it. Fortunately, products can improve vaginal lubrication and reduce pain during intercourse.
